CVE-2021-47160

Cross-bridge traffic leakage via stale port matrix

Published Mar 25, 2024 · Updated Aug 5, 2026

Information disclosure in the Linux MT7530 DSA driver allows attackers to read traffic across logically isolated network bridges. mt7530_port_set_vlan_aware sets PCR_MATRIX to all members when VLAN filtering is enabled but does not restore isolation when filtering is disabled. Exploitation requires MT7530 switch hardware, a shared Layer 2 network, and bridges whose VLAN filtering was enabled and then disabled.
